Lloyds Bank Foundation Specialist Fund
This programme is for small, local, specialist charities supporting people facing complex issues.
Under this programme we will support charities to strengthen their capacity and capabilities and become more resilient through a range of tailored development support offers alongside a three-year unrestricted grant of £75,000.
The deadline for applications is Thursday, 25 January 2024, 5pm

Acton Connect Launch Event
Date: 23rd Nov
Time: 12pm-2:30pm
Venue: Acton Gardens Community Centre, Unit A, Munster Court Bollo Bridge Road London W3 8UU
Acton Connect is a new project funded by London Borough of Ealing aiming to help Acton residents to reduce isolation, connect with other people and to take part in regular and shared activities. These activities will aim to reduce loneliness and isolation and the project will be co-ordinated by Ealing and Hounslow CVS (EHCVS).
This launch event will have presentations from EHCVS, its partners and stallholders on funding support, volunteering opportunities and some of the community activities which will be on offer as part of the Acton Connect project.
Following the presentations there will be networking and Light refreshments.

The Hong Kong community needs survey
Ealing Council would like to learn more about the new residents from Hong Kong to design local services that would meet their needs.

This survey will continue til 31 January 2024 and will help us understand patterns of migration, how Honkongers access information, and what is needed to successfully settle. Any information received as part of this survey will be used only by Ealing Council to improve its services to local Hongkongers.

Your Voice Your Town
Ealing Council is reaching out across the borough to find out how local people will find it easiest to talk to the council about their towns and neighbourhoods. Your Voice, Your Town aims to bring local people into the decisions that are made about the places where they live. The campaign is aimed at making sure everyone who wants to, will be able to take part in talking about and making decisions in their local area.
